Plasma-Catalytic Process of Hydrogen Production from Mixture of Methanol and Water

Bogdan Ulejczyk et al.

Summary: In the present study, hydrogen production process was conducted in a plasma-catalytic reactor, with substrates treated by plasma and introduced into the catalyst bed. The highest hydrogen production was 1.38 mol/h, and increasing discharge power resulted in higher methanol conversion and hydrogen production. The synergy effect between plasma and catalyst was observed, leading to efficient hydrogen production.

CATALYSTS (2021)
